Wordpress: all links redirect to home page

yesterday i moved a customer website to my server, everything went fine except for the fact that all menu links redirect to the home page.

i already tried deactivating all plugins, checked the .htaccess and activated the default theme.

basically the page is a 1:1 copy of the previously working page on the old server, the apache log says on every link 301 redirect…

"GET /index.php HTTP/1.0" 301 339 " http://quartieracht.de/property-status/kauf-haus/ " "Mozilla/5.0 (iPad; CPU OS 8_3 like Mac OS X) AppleWebKit/600.1.4 (KHTML, like Gecko) Version/8.0 Mobile/12F69 Safari/600.1.4"

the funny part is: i did a second copy of the webspace here: http://test.teamnifty.com , its the same server and it works. so i thought i might just move the whole thing to the quartieracht.de folder and change the domain name in the database, but still the same problem…

  1. Log into the WordPress Dashboard.
  2. In the side panel, go to Settings > Permalinks.
  3. Make note of the current setting. (If you are using a custom structure, copy or save the custom structure somewhere.)
  4. Select the Default option.
  5. Click Save Changes.
  6. Now select the previous setting you had before Default was selected.
  7. Click Save Changes.
